About Multiplication Table Drill
Master Your Times Tables with Interactive Drilling
Multiplication is one of those foundational skills that everything else in mathematics builds upon. Long division, fractions, algebra, percentages, area calculations: they all assume you can multiply fluently. Yet many students struggle with their times tables well into secondary school, not because the concept is difficult, but because they have never practised enough to achieve true automaticity. The Multiplication Table Drill provides the focused, repetitive practice that transforms multiplication from a slow, deliberate calculation into an instant, reflexive response.
Why Drill Practice Works
Cognitive science is clear on this point: certain skills need to be practised until they become automatic. When a student has to stop and think about what 7 times 8 equals, that cognitive effort takes resources away from understanding the larger problem they are trying to solve. When the answer 56 comes instantly, those mental resources are freed up for higher-order thinking. Multiplication drills build this automaticity through spaced repetition, the most effective learning technique known to educational psychology.
The Multiplication Table Drill is designed around this principle. It presents problems in a format that encourages speed and accuracy, tracks your performance, and focuses additional practice on the specific facts you find most challenging. This targeted approach is far more efficient than simply reciting times tables from one to twelve, because it concentrates your effort where it is needed most.

The Tricky Ones Everyone Struggles With
Research into multiplication errors reveals that certain facts are universally difficult. The 7, 8, and 9 times tables produce the most errors across all age groups. Specific combinations like 6x7, 7x8, 8x9, and 6x8 are notorious stumbling blocks. The Multiplication Table Drill can be configured to focus on these problem areas, giving you intensive practice on exactly the facts that trip you up rather than wasting time on the easy ones you already know.
There is also the issue of directional fluency. Many students can recite 3x7=21 but hesitate at 7x3, even though the answer is identical. The drill presents problems in varied orientations to build bidirectional fluency, ensuring that you can access any multiplication fact regardless of how the question is framed.
